Electrolux - 4.5 Cu.Ft. Stackable Front Load Washer with Steam and LuxCare® Wash System - White

Find big savings on Electrolux Washer(s) at Appliances Helpers. Open Box and Floor Model Discounts Available on Major Brand Appliances! Low Prices. The Electrolux front load washer features LuxCare® Wash and Perfect Steam™ technology to provide a thorough clean for clothing and fabrics. The 18-Minute Fast Wash cycle allows you to quickly deep-clean the items you need the most.

We built a new home and purchased all new appliances in 2009. We bought an Electrolux French Door Refrigerator and a 30 Double Convection Wall Oven. The first thing to go was the panel on the wall oven. Then the Ice Maker. Twice. Both under warranty fortunately. Then the French Door had to be replaced because the magnet at the bottom of the door kept sticking and we had to pull on the door so hard to get it to open that the door split open. Luckily we were good friend with our Appliance Sales folks and they got an Electrolux Sales Guy to give us a new door. Now the ovens dont work. Started with the lower oven not coming up to temperature. Lets not even talk about either of the temp oven probes which are so badly designed they cant tell the difference between the oven temp and the food temp, so they either turn off the oven to keep warm before your food is cooked, or they cook at the temp you tried to set for the food. Dont think 140 for beef is going to cook anything. Anyway, back to the lower oven. Oven panel says one temp, but gauge set in the oven says much lower. Then the upper oven started doing the same thing. Had a tech look at it, and he asked if I had just run the cleaning cycle. When I said yes, his response was Dont run a cleaning cycle before a Holiday! Meaning that the oven problems happen during a cleaning cycle. Anyway, both oven liners have buckled and are touching the heating elements, causing them to ground out. I need two oven liners, two heating elements, one relay panel, two guys and four hours of labor to repair by oven. Total $2,400 for an oven I paid $3,600 for 5 years ago. You would think you would get more than 5 years of an appliance. Then the French Door went again. This time its the major electrical panel, so now that another $500 service and part repair. Six months after my purchase of a washer/dryer from Electrolux (front load washer EFLW417SIW0), we began to have to run anywhere from 3-7 extra rinse cycles to get the soap left in the clothes to an acceptable level. Today, turning on the machine, with no clothes and no soap, the water begins to fill with suds in less than five minutes. We wash towels without adding soap. Electrolux customer service was contacted in July 2017, and the endless cavalcade of repair men started coming to my house. The first repair person indicated that I needed to run loads of vinegar and bleach (alternating) to reduce internal soap buildup in the machine. We ran in excess of 30 loads and still had soap appearing from nowhere. Called Electrolux customer service and the second repair person says the same thing. So we continue. Now, in excess of 70 loads of cleaner (alternating bleach and vinegar) and a $128 water bill, I still have soap in my machine.Called Electrolux and escalated to a supervisor. Supervisor insisted on sending out another repair person and that I should ask them to call the Electrolux factory technician help line while he is at my house for further instruction. I made their request, the repair person refused to call. I escalated to the next level of management and another repair person was ordered. During this ordeal, I was told by at least three people at Electrolux that my machine needed to be replaced. Each time I was told this, the representative put me on hold and came back and said that they would have to have another technician come out to the house. I agreed each time and did exactly as I was asked to do.Keep in mind, at no time did any of the technicians that came to my house ever open the machine and look inside to see if there was a problem. They witnessed the soap, took pictures, and told me to clean the machine. We are now in excess of 100 washer loads of cleaning solution with both bleach and vinegar and Affresh, and still have soap in the Each time we had someone come out, I reiterated that this is not our first HE machine and that the only soap we use is HE detergent, using MUCH less than the minimum amount of soap. Due to skin allergies, we use fragrance free and allergen free soap, and 1-2 tablespoons per load. When items are not very dirty, we use no soap, as there is enough latent soap in the machine to wash the clothes. The machine has never failed diagnostics and has never exhibited an error code, even when the machine was completely filled with suds all the way to the top during cleaning cycles.After visit number FIVE from another technician, I re-escalated to a second level supervisor. I was told there is nothing wrong with my machine and there was nothing more that could be done. So, after five technicians, each of which acknowledged there was obviously a problem, I still have no resolution. The final technician that showed up said that this is most likely due to soap build-up between the drums inside the machine. He indicated that the repair cost could approach the cost of the machine as these machines are not built to be serviceable. He estimated the costs at one $600 to remove the drums, clean them, and put things back together. The machine was purchased for $900. And he said that Electrolux would not approve the work to be done.On top of that, Electrolux only pays the technician if a problem is found and repaired.
